Aberystwyth Engineer.
[portrait of J. J. McPherson in his sailor uniform]
Mr. J. J. McPHERSON,
Son of Mr. and Mrs. McPherson, Clyde House, Queen's-road, was on the "Leasowe Castle" troopship when it was torpedoed and 101 lost their lives; but was safely landed at Alexandria. Mr. J. McPherson assisted in the building of the ship at Cammel Laird's Yard.
Source:
'Aberystwyth Engineer.' The Cambrian News and Welsh Farmers' Gazette. 14 June 1918. 3.
